The Phenomenon of Ice Piracy: A Glacier’s Surprising Conduct

Regardless of its amusing sound, “ice piracy” has severe ramifications. Scientists have seen the Kohler East Glacier in West Antarctica’s Pope, Smith, and Kohler (PSK) region actively stealing ice from its slower-moving neighbour, Kohler West. Kohler East has been accelerating and thinning extra shortly between 2005 and 2022, absorbing ice from Kohler West at a fee that has delayed the latter’s stream by 10%, in accordance with satellite tv for pc information from missions like Copernicus Sentinel-1 and the European Space Agency’s CryoSat. Within the meantime, stream charges at Kohler East and neighbouring Smith West Glacier have elevated by as a lot as 560 meters yearly.

In distinction to previous tendencies, the place comparable actions have been thought to take tons of or 1000’s of years, this rerouting of ice stream is a dramatic change. To confirm the fast change, the College of Leeds workforce, below the route of PhD researcher Heather L. Selley, measured the displacement of floor options, together with rifts and crevasses, utilizing subtle monitoring strategies. Co-author of the paper, Professor Anna Hogg, pressured that mannequin forecasting Antarctica’s future evolution should think about this “ice piracy,” a major new mechanism in trendy ice sheet dynamics. The outcomes, which have been launched on Might 8, 2025, in The Cryosphere, exhibit how quickly glacial techniques can destabilise or adapt to altering environmental situations.

Local weather Change because the Driving Drive Behind Speedy Ice Circulation

The bigger backdrop of local weather change is the first reason behind this Antarctic glacier caught in ice piracy. The glaciers of Antarctica are extremely weak to environmental adjustments, particularly in West Antarctica, which is house to the PSK area. Warming ocean temperatures and shifting ocean currents are liable for a number of the area’s highest charges of thinning and grounding-line retreat ever seen. Ice stream patterns are rearranged because the ocean melts the grounding zone, the place glaciers go from being based mostly on bedrock to floating on water. In keeping with the research’s co-author, Dr. Pierre Dutrieux of the British Antarctic Survey, this melting has led upstream ice in the direction of glaciers that transfer extra shortly, comparable to Kohler East, so “stealing” ice from slower neighbours.

The PSK area will not be the one place the place this phenomenon happens. Speedy thinning additionally seems in different areas of Antarctica, such because the Aurora Subglacial Basin, the place the Vanderford Glacier receded 18.6 km between 1996 and 2020. The overall pattern of accelerating ice stream immediately outcomes from glacier instability and diminishing ice cabinets introduced on by global warming. The PSK area’s Dotson and Crosson Ice Shelves, which get their ice from the Kohler glaciers, are additionally impacted. The mass flux into these cabinets has modified as a result of rerouting of ice stream, which can stabilise Dotson whereas hastening Crosson’s degradation. This dynamic interplay highlights how interdependent and vulnerable Antarctica’s ice techniques are to adjustments introduced on by the local weather.

Implications for Sea Degree Rise and World Communities

Large-ranging results end result from Antarctica’s fast-paced ice piracy, particularly on sea ranges worldwide. Ocean ranges rise as a direct results of melting ice within the Amundsen Sea, which receives its feed from the glaciers within the PSK area. World sea ranges have already elevated by greater than 10 cm within the final ten years, and if present tendencies proceed, it’s predicted that over 410 million folks could also be prone to coastal flooding by the 12 months 2100. As a result of it has the potential to vary the tempo of ice loss from Antarctica drastically, the College of Leeds research cautions that the noticed rerouting of ice stream must be included in prediction fashions.

In keeping with earlier research from the College of Leeds, the Amundsen Sea Embayment alone has misplaced over 3,000 billion tonnes of ice within the final 25 years, making West Antarctica a major contributor to rising sea ranges. The glaciers within the PSK area are important, regardless that they’re smaller than the close by Thwaites Glacier, which is called the “Doomsday Glacier” as a result of it’d increase sea ranges by 65 cm if it falls. The ice piracy seen right here could worsen the instability of close by ice cabinets, which could result in a melting chain response that quickens sea stage rise. This further surge would possibly improve the chance of flooding in coastal areas like New York, that are already sinking as a consequence of groundwater extraction, endangering infrastructure and uprooting residents.
